Output 5d8a223b02c34f2edb147efc8985ea52152d8da4d9bd3d21ddebdcc9370d054d:13

value
564300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58880b6009b48285b80facf1dcec9c0aa4820336 OP_EQUAL
address
39m8MxWPzS8aLpWyg75yYHhDK6aVKmvBMz
transaction
5d8a223b02c34f2edb147efc8985ea52152d8da4d9bd3d21ddebdcc9370d054d
spent
true